WTN: 2007 Futo Ov & 2006 Harris Estate Cab (Treva's)

by Jason Hagen » Fri May 21, 2010 5:29 pm

  • 2007 Futo OV - USA, California, Napa Valley, Oakville (5/7/2010)
    We drank half the bottle last night. I kept checking on it through the night as it sat in the glass. A tasty oak bomb. Sweet creamy fruit. Actually very nice balance for the style but the price is a bit of a joke. Will finish the bottle tomorrow night and give an update.
    Actually we waited an extra night and then the wine also sat in my glass for about 4 hours. Really not much change as far as flavors developing. When I am craving this style of wine, this would certainly fit the bill ... but not the $$ bill. It is listed at 15.5% but the alch seemed to suit the wine. (90 pts.)

  • 2006 Harris Estate Vineyards Cabernet Sauvignon Treva's Vineyard - USA, California, Napa Valley (3/5/2010)
    This is certainly young. I tried early, gave lots of air and the left for the next day. Very enjoyable and a lot of tannic and acid structure but otherwise it seemed to lack complexity. Admittedly it is very difficult to get past the oak, and I don't mind oak but this is oakity oak. I would have liked a little more concentration to match the oak. With the structure this wine should show improvement hence my score. (89 pts.)
